Hello everyone,

i have AOS interview next week. i will be glad if anyone can tell me, what are the LISTS possible required documents, i will need to take with me to the interview.

your quick response will be highly appreciated.

in my Experience going to AOS interview, photo of you both,bills,insurance with your both name on it,if you have baby bring his/her birth certificate,thats all I remember I bring in our interview...oh yah your birth certificate , marriage contract, if one of you got devorce need that devorce certificate..thats all i remember...

Im not sure anyone knows what they will ask for. At our interview we took tons of documents. They only asked for 2006 tax return, his passport and birth cert. They didnt ask anything from me not even a question. I say be over prepared than under each officer is different.

Well people above have already jotted down the documentation requirement.

I had almost all of the above mentioned documents with me but you know what..my approver was probably in a rush or may be too easy going!!

Apart from the photographs she did not ask for any other documents. Not even our birth certificates!

Moreover, i spent 200 bucks getting the entire medical done since I applied for my AOS in the 12th month from my medical in home country..but she told me that the medical was also not required.

Its always good and safe to be hundred percent prepared but if you have an interviewer like ours at the end of ething you will feel oh I pulled my hair to hard stressing out!!
